KKR Expands Altavair Ownership Stake

KKR is increasing its ownership in Altavair, a Washington-based aircraft leasing firm, and its sister company, AV AirFinance. The private equity giant has committed over $5 billion to aircraft leasing and lending deals since its strategic partnership with Altavair began in 2018.

The move deepens KKR's foothold in a sector that has seen strong demand for financing. Altavair has facilitated more than $14.5 billion in commercial aircraft lease transactions since 2003, serving over 80 airlines across 50 countries with more than 300 Boeing and Airbus jets.

Leadership changes accompany the stake increase. Matthew Hoesley, Altavair's chief commercial officer, will become president and chief commercial officer, while Andrew Carpenter, head of tax and accounting, will assume the CFO role. These appointments signal KKR's intent to steer the firm's next growth phase.
